Russian Drone Strike On Ukrainian Workers’ Bus Claims Nine Lives, Dozens Injured. A Russian drone strike early on Wednesday morning has claimed the lives of at least nine people and injured 30 others after targeting a bus carrying workers in Ukraine’s Dnipropetrovsk region, according to regional officials. The attack took place in the city of Marganets, located around 10 kilometres from the front line. Sergiy Lysak, the governor of the region, confirmed the fatalities in a post on Telegram and said the number of injured continued to rise as emergency services responded to the incident. NiMet Workers Launch Indefinite Strike, Halting Meteorological Services Across Nigeria. Workers at the Nigerian Meteorological Agency (NiMet) have embarked on an indefinite strike, effectively shutting down all meteorological services nationwide. The action, which began on 22 April 2025, stems from long-standing grievances over poor remuneration and unfulfilled agreements, raising concerns about potential disruptions to aviation operations. PSG Smash Historic Record With 39-Game Unbeaten Away Run In Europe’s Top Leagues. Paris Saint-Germain have etched their name into football history by setting a new record for the longest unbeaten away run in Europe’s top five leagues, surpassing AC Milan’s longstanding mark from 1993. The French champions achieved this remarkable feat with an extraordinary streak of 39 consecutive away matches without defeat, comprising 30 wins and 9 draws, as confirmed following their latest Ligue 1 triumph on 22 April 2025. NAHCON Confirms May 9 For Inaugural 2025 Hajj Flight, Pushes For Financial Reforms. The National Hajj Commission of Nigeria (NAHCON) has confirmed that the inaugural flight for the 2025 Hajj pilgrimage will depart for the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ia on 9 May, 2025. This marks the official commencement of Nigeria’s participation in this year’s holy pilgrimage. As part of its comprehensive preparations, NAHCON has finalised the allocation of 43,000 intending pilgrims across four approved airlines.
